Part of EHR's problems are definitely that the market is only one single country, the United States.




And even within that single country, each state and hospital then has their own requirements around EHRs. This ends up being my biggest issue with EHR is that you need to support infinite flexibility for all the unique snowflakes that exist. I'm convinced healthcare would improve in this country if the federal government standardized all of this to a single setup. This also includes the mess that is EHR in EMS.
